About Pastor Nathan

Family: My beautiful wife is Lenzie Cobb. Together, we have two wonderful boys; Coda and Kai. Lenzie and I married in October of 2019 and have been at Legacy Church since February of the same year.

Ministry Role: I have been the Admin at Legacy, the Young Adults Leader, and now serve as the Connections Pastor. I often tell people my job can be summed up in a simple phrase: “Connecting you to people and places that you fit best.” I mainly oversee our Serve Teams & Volunteers, Assimilation, Membership, and Connect Groups (small groups).
